The Violence Prevention Network, the Amadeu Antonio Foundation, and the Center for Applied Deradicalization Research launched “Advice Compass on Conspiracy Thinking” (Beratungskompass Verschwörungsdenken) in 2024 as part of the “LivingDemocracy!” project. “Conspiracy theories are accompanied by lies and disinformation. They are deliberately spread to divide our society and destroy trust in independent science, free media, and democratic institutions. Conspiracy theories can lead to extremist ideologies and drive perpetrators to commit crimes and acts of violence. Antisemitic conspiracy theories are particularly often spread,” Federal Interior Minister Nancy Faeser said.
The government’s own website discusses how important it was to silence “disinformation” during the COVID-19 pandemic. The government is urging citizens to be on the lookout for anyone spreading conspiracies surrounding the war in Ukraine
Their website warns the public to look for “people in the immediate environment. Such as family, friends, or school” as they may reveal their independent thinking to the people closest to them. “Open dialogue on equal terms often seems impossible because the other person is not receptive to arguments,” the government states, warning citizens that they should report these free thinkers to authorities who are trained to combat extremism.
“Those seeking advice will receive initial orientation and help in finding suitable counseling services nearby. After a confidential initial consultation, those affected will be referred to a specialized agency if necessary. In this way, we provide very concrete support to those affected and their families while simultaneously strengthening prevention efforts to protect our society from the growing dangers of conspiracy theories,” stated Federal Minister for Family Affairs Lisa Paus, who called conspiracy theories “poisonous to democracy.”
